Anterior column realignment via a minimally invasive hybrid approach in adult spinal deformity surgery: an analysis of radiographic and clinical outcomes

Abstract Background :Osteotomy and Orthopedics is the leading way to treat adult spinal deformity (ASD), but there are many surgical complications. meanwhile, oblique lumbar interbody fusion(OLIF) and anterior lumbar interbody fusion (ALIF) have becoming an increasingly popular surgical method of spinal surgery. Thus, the purpose of this study is to explore the feasibility and safety of minimally invasive anterior column realignment(ACR) in the treatment of adult spinal deformities. Methods: A total of 64 patients were included in the study. All patients received OLIF and/or ALIF and ACR, combined with Percutaneous pedicle screw fixation(PPSF). The surgical effect was evaluated by the operation time, bleeding volume, intervertebral space angle (IVA), lumbar lordosis (LL), the sagittal vertical axis (SVA), visual analog pain score (VAS), Japanese orthopedic association scores (JOA) and complications. Results: All patients completed 173 fusion segments; For 155 segments of ACR surgery, the average sagittal correction angle of each ACR segment was 15.3 ° ± 5.8 °. The mean preoperative and postoperative lumbar lordosis were, respectively, -16.7 ° ± 6.4 °and -48.6 ° ± 10.7 ° (p<0.001). JOA, VAS and other scores were significantly improved compared with those before operation. Conclusion: Anterior column realignment via a minimally invasive hybrid approach for adult spinal deformity can achieve good clinical outcome and deformity correction.
